WiFly is a handy device with reasonable processing, coupled with multi-range, removable antennas for scanning in-range Wi-Fi devices. Its detailed information gathering, and passive scanning would firstly apprise the administrators about Wi-Fi access points which are illegally operating in the vicinity and secondly, provide all minute details about these internet connections like (MACs, vendor IDs, country of origin, encryption standard, connected devices etc.). It would also give detailed information of all company systems connected to these unlawful internet connections, which would help apprehend the disgruntled human resources. Moreover, WiFly would have a feature to block these unlawful connections so that no one can connect to these access points. It would also have a feature to penetrate these Wi-Fi networks by launching a wide variety of wireless attacks for launching further reconnaissance and scanning (both active and passive) on connected clients. The proposed device WiFly would offer an easy-to-use interface for administrators to manage and control the device. Due to its small size, this portable device can easily be hand carried, mounted on vehicles, buildings and even a drone so that it can seamlessly capture and analyze the traffic. |
